SPOT ON 75648 Hotel Hill Fort Inn
6-2-29/A/1,House No. 6-2-29/A/1, Skyline Building, Beside Lotus Children Hospital, Lakdikapul, P ,Hyderabad Hyderabad, India
Hotel Star | Rates | Checkin | Checkout | Rating |
---|---|---|---|---|
3 | USD 0 | 12:00 PM | 11:00 AM | 0 (0 reviews) |